型安全– tag –
-
Kotlinのスマートキャストで安全な型変換を実現する方法
Kotlinは、モダンなプログラミング言語としてJavaの互換性を持ちながら、よりシンプルで安全なコーディングを可能にします。その中でも、Kotlinの特徴的な機能の一つに... -
Kotlinのスマートキャストでリスト要素を安全に処理する方法を徹底解説
Kotlinでリストの要素を処理する際、型安全に操作することはエラーを防ぐために重要です。特に複数の異なる型が混在するリストや、Nullableな要素が存在する場合、適切... -
Kotlinスマートキャストの仕組みと使い方を完全解説
Kotlinにおいて、スマートキャストは型安全なプログラミングを実現する強力な機能です。通常、プログラム内で変数の型が不明確な場合、開発者は型チェックを行い、その... -
Rustで関数の不適切な型エラーを解決する方法を完全ガイド
Rustにおける型システムは、プログラムの安全性と効率性を高めるために設計されています。しかし、関数に不適切な型の引数を渡したり、期待される型と異なる戻り値を返... -
Rustの標準トレイトによる型安全な比較操作を徹底解説
Rustプログラミング言語は、高いパフォーマンスとメモリ安全性を両立することで知られています。その中で特に注目すべきなのが、型安全性を保証するための独自の設計で... -
Rustで型駆動開発を実践する:型定義と安全性向上のベストプラクティス
型駆動開発は、ソフトウェア設計において型の設計を軸に据えることで、安全性や可読性を向上させる手法です。Rustは、その強力な型システムとコンパイル時チェック機能... -
Rustでトレイトを使った型安全なイベントハンドリングの実装方法
Rustはその型安全性と高い性能から、多くのシステムプログラミングの分野で注目されています。特に、型安全性を活かしたイベントハンドリングの実装は、エラーの少ない... -
Rustで学ぶジェネリクスを活用した型安全なデータ構造設計
Rustは、型安全性とパフォーマンスを重視したプログラミング言語として、近年ますます注目を集めています。その中でもジェネリクス(Generics)は、コードの再利用性を... -
Rustで型安全設計を活用してエラーを防ぐ方法
Rustは、その革新的な型システムを活用して、プログラミングにおける多くの一般的なエラーをコンパイル時に防ぐことができる言語として注目されています。型安全性とは...